Output ef7238066eb532f3fdce27d511ad31317a2d0dc0f953cccd2307b7be454bbe2f:9

value
52664899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a18419856d7144f79f3dc47720fd43961161265c OP_EQUAL
address
MNdBGmAzd8FtpdMQBJMULvRu4nMAQV2Swt
transaction
ef7238066eb532f3fdce27d511ad31317a2d0dc0f953cccd2307b7be454bbe2f
spent
true